Martin Damm holds a substantial edge in the Winston-Salem Open round-of-64 matchup on outdoor hard courts, driven by his ATP ranking of 94 compared to Shelbayh’s 253 and stronger recent results. Damm posted a career-high ranking in August 2026 and enters with an overall 7-11 record that includes a semifinal run earlier in the year, while Shelbayh’s form remains limited with a 4-13 mark and no titles. The pair met previously on hard courts in Washington qualifying, where Damm prevailed in three sets after dropping the opener. Bettors reflect this gap through heavy consensus on Damm, citing his serve consistency, experience at ATP 250 level, and home-soil comfort as decisive factors against a lower-ranked opponent still seeking consistent breakthroughs.
